Saint Peter and Saint Paul Coptic Orthodox Church of Oakville is a charitable organization based in Oakville, Ontario, classified by the CRA under christianity.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$2.8M in revenue and $1.5M in expenditures.
Its funding that year was roughly 84% from donations. In 2024, 3 other registered charities reported granting it a combined $73K.
Compared with 2,238 religious char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 20% of peers. Its highest-paid positions fell in the $80,000–119,999 range (2 positions in that band). The charity reported 2 permanent full-time positions.
It reported gifts to 2 qualified donees totalling $51K in 2024, the largest being $48K to The Coptic Orthodox Diocese of Mississauga Vancouver & Western Canada.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$1.6M in 2020 to $2.8M in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 9 names.
In its own words
A) to advance and teach the religious tenets doctrines and observances associated with the christian coptic orthodox faith. B) to establish maintain and support a house of worship with services conducted in accordance with the tenets and doctrines of the christian coptic orthodox faith.
Ongoing-program description from its T3010 filing, verbatim.
